This is lesson 13 of 30 in the unit "From Wetlands to Wheelie Bins". Lesson Title: Graphing Our Discoveries Lesson Description: Graph species observed during the field trip and analyze data visually.
Lesson 13 of 30, “From Wetlands to Wheelie Bins”, builds on students’ field-trip observations by turning species counts into clear representations. Students will make a simple column graph, interpret patterns in the data, and use evidence to describe what the observations suggest.
0–5 min · Recall & purpose. Teacher revisits the field-trip question: “Which species did we observe most and least, and what pattern do we notice?” Students share one observation category they recorded.
5–12 min · Data check (table building). Teacher models a quick “species-count” table using a sample (Species | Count) and reminds students to check totals match original tally marks. Students complete their own table from their field-trip class or group dataset.
12–22 min · Choose representation (column graph or pictograph). Teacher demonstrates how to convert counts into a column graph (x-axis: species; y-axis: number of individuals) and explains that each bar height must match the table value. Students create a column graph on provided paper or a digital template; if using pictographs, they agree on the “one symbol =? individuals” key and place symbols accurately.
22–30 min · Graph accuracy mini-check. Teacher circulates with a checklist: axis labels present, scale appropriate, bars/symbols align to numbers, title written. Students do a peer “spot check” and correct one issue if needed.
30–40 min · Interpret patterns. Teacher prompts: “Which species has the highest bar? Lowest bar? Are there equal counts? What does that pattern suggest?” Students write 3–4 sentences interpreting the graph using evidence (e.g., “We observed more of…” “Two species were tied…”).
40–45 min · Quick scientific explanation (exit ticket). Teacher asks one final question: “What does the data show about the wetland species we observed, and what evidence from the graph supports your idea?” Students complete an exit ticket with one claim and one piece of graph evidence.
